Oracle
奔跑的小男孩
明天会为自己今天的努力而感到骄傲。
展开
-
inner join left right full +
SELECT * FROM dept; SELECT * FROM emp; --inner join 意思是内连接 把匹配的信息全部查出来,如果关联字段中主表为空,则不显示 select e.empno,e.ename,e.job,d.deptno,d.dname from emp e INNER join dept d on e.deptno=d.deptno OR原创 2017-10-11 12:54:11 · 198 阅读 · 0 评论 -
oracle中的exists 和not exists 用法详解
有两个简单例子,以说明 “exists”和“in”的效率问题 1) select * from T1 where exists(select 1 from T2 where T1.a=T2.a) ; T1数据量小而T2数据量非常大时,T1 2) select * from T1 where T1.a in (select T2.a from T2) ;原创 2017-12-06 09:22:26 · 236 阅读 · 0 评论